Fulvic Acid for Cognitive Function

Preliminary evidence 10 studies

Research suggests that fulvic acid shows early preclinical promise for cognitive health, particularly in the context of Alzheimer's disease pathology, with laboratory studies consistently reporting that it can inhibit the formation of tau protein tangles and amyloid-beta aggregates, reduce protein clumping associated with both Alzheimer's and Parkinson's disease, and demonstrate neuroprotective effects against oxidative stress and heavy metal toxicity in animal models. The available evidence base consists predominantly of in vitro and in silico studies, a small number of animal experiments, and one narrative review that included a limited clinical trial component examining shilajit — a natural substance rich in fulvic acid — in patients with mild Alzheimer's disease, with all findings pointing in a supportive direction though none constituting robust clinical proof. Studies indicate that fulvic acid has also been explored in combination formulations alongside compounds like Bacopa monnieri, where animal behavioral studies suggested improvements in memory performance, though it is difficult to isolate fulvic acid's specific contribution in multi-ingredient preparations. The overall body of evidence remains at an early, largely preclinical stage, with no large-scale randomized controlled trials establishing efficacy or safety in humans, meaning conclusions about meaningful cognitive benefit cannot yet be drawn from the existing literature.
